Merge branch '42-create-auto-deployment-pipeline' into 'master'

Resolve "Create auto deployment pipeline"

Closes #42

See merge request marcel.schwarz/2020ss-qbc-geofence-timetracking!25
This commit is contained in:
Marcel Schwarz 2020-04-28 22:41:42 +00:00
commit 87ef3fe09e

30
.gitlab-ci.yml Normal file
View File

@ -0,0 +1,30 @@
build-vue:
image: docker:latest
stage: build
services:
- docker:dind
script:
- cd frontend
- docker build --pull -t vue .
only:
- merge_requests
build-backend:
image: docker:latest
stage: build
services:
- docker:dind
script:
- cd backend
- docker build --pull -t backend .
only:
- merge_requests
build-android:
image: debian
stage: build
script:
- echo "To be done"
only:
- merge_requests